Quick tip from a man who I call "Mr Port Hacking" (and for good reason!)...if fishing dead baits, fish with NO WEIGHT and with the BAIL ARM OPEN! You want the fish to run with the bait for a bit, so leave the bail arm open and let it run. Any weight added will make the fish drop the bait all together. He has landed literally thousands of Jews from the decades he's been fishing the Hacking and his PB is 62lb using this method.

Onya for getting out there though, try this method and your fish should come, that's what happened to me!

P.S. The legal size for flatties is 36cm, not 35cm. Keeping undersized fish is WRONG mate.
